METHOD FOR EVALUATING NON-EUCLIDIAN EFFECTS AFFECTING AN IMAGE OBTAINED WITH A SPATIAL RADAR, AND SATELLITE FOR ITS IMPLEMENTATION

The invention relates to a method for evaluating the phase shift associated with the propagation of a wave emitted by a space radar through the ionosphere. BR/ This method comprises the steps of: BR/ - forming a first (1c) and a second (2c) interferogram from two pairs of radar images (1a, 1b, 2a, 2b) obtained using respectively two space radars working at respective wavelengths lambda1 and lambda2 checking the relationship m lambda1 = n lambda2, where m and n are integers, said radars being placed on the same satellite, BR/ - performing the linear combination n vphi1 - m vphi2 of the respective phases vphi1 and vphi2 of the first and second interferograms, the part fractional fraction of this linear combination being representative of the non-Euclidean effects affecting the images of the space radars used to produce said interferograms.
